English Bookcase Secretary with Moroccan Style Glass Doors, 19th Century
About the Item
English secretary with glass door and three glass shelves, leather inlay on desk surface, original glass panels, 19th Century. There is one crack on one of the glass panels which we can replace, but would like to give the opportunity to the client to make that decision.
The design of the doors have a Moroccan influence design.
- Dimensions:Height: 88.5 in (224.79 cm)Width: 28 in (71.12 cm)Depth: 21 in (53.34 cm)
